Re: AVG 8 FREE won't update, Help?

This might help to solve the problem. first do a restart to see if that will fix it, if not uninstall the program, click on start, then control panel click on classic view, then double click on Programs and Features. This will bring up Uninstalle or change a program. Locate the AVG 8.0 and RIGHT click on it. You will see two options uninstall or change click on uninstall and this will remove the program. Go back to the AVG web site and installed the program. You will get the latest version with all the update. Then click on the update if it doesn't automaticly update. Report back and post the results. Make sure you have a Internet Connection, good luck.

Re: AVG 8 FREE won't update, Help?

I had the same problem also. Mine was with windows firewall, I had to manually add AVG to the add/program tab. Once I did that it updated just fine. What firewall are you using?
